Where communities thrive


  • Join over 1.5M+ people
  • Join over 100K+ communities
  • Free without limits
  • Create your own community
People
Activity
  • Jan 23 12:35

    ppratscher on master

    Feature/design (#39) * Design:… (compare)

  • Jan 23 09:42

    ppratscher on master

    Feature/design (#37) * Design:… (compare)

  • Jan 21 13:22

    ppratscher on master

    Create an index for validatorin… (compare)

  • Jan 21 12:51

    ppratscher on master

    Store validators-state of lates… (compare)

  • Jan 20 13:59

    ppratscher on master

    Design Fixes (#34) * Design: v… (compare)

  • Jan 20 12:51

    ppratscher on master

    Updated the design (#33) * Des… (compare)

  • Jan 19 19:01

    ppratscher on master

    Make active validators searchab… (compare)

  • Jan 19 15:56

    ppratscher on master

    Increate timeout for lighthouse… (compare)

  • Jan 19 09:47

    ppratscher on master

    Improve export error handling (compare)

  • Jan 17 21:41

    ppratscher on master

    Do not exit the process on fail… (compare)

  • Jan 17 21:38

    ppratscher on master

    Add support for deposits on the… (compare)

  • Jan 17 12:59

    ppratscher on master

    Show exact date as tooltip (#32) (compare)

  • Jan 17 10:31

    ppratscher on master

    Show correct attestation status… (compare)

  • Jan 17 10:12

    ppratscher on master

    Display times of epochs on vali… (compare)

  • Jan 17 08:17

    ppratscher on master

    Update landing page (compare)

  • Jan 17 08:14

    ppratscher on master

    Estimate activationEpoch for pe… (compare)

  • Jan 16 16:00

    ppratscher on master

    Fix: Feature/design (#29) Fix … (compare)

  • Jan 16 14:38

    ppratscher on master

    Design Update (#27) * Design: … (compare)

  • Jan 14 13:56

    ppratscher on master

    Option to update the statistics… Merge remote-tracking branch 'g… (compare)

  • Jan 14 09:28

    ppratscher on master

    Make pending validators searcha… (compare)

Peter Pratscher
@ppratscher
it looks like your db password is not set correctly or blank
Tom_Wang
@TomWang10
@ppratscher I executed tables.sql
image.png
INFO[0000] Error retrieving latest epoch from the database: sql: Scan error on column index 0, name "max": converting NULL to uint64 is unsupported module=services
FATA[0000] rpc error: code = Internal desc = grpc: failed to unmarshal the received message proto: wrong wireType = 2
threw this error
Stefan Star
@stefan_star_twitter
Sounds like the db scanner is trying to convert a null value into a uint64
Peter Pratscher
@ppratscher
yes, you will first have to let the indexer put some data into the db before you start the frontend
but we will also fix the panic error
Tom_Wang
@TomWang10
I closed frontend
Peter Pratscher
@ppratscher
also it seems the indexer is unable to connect to your prysm node
Tom_Wang
@TomWang10
FATA[0000] rpc error: code = Internal desc = grpc: failed to unmarshal the received message proto: wrong wireType = 2 for field FinalizedBlockSlot module=exporter
still error
image.png
my node seems work
gRPC connection to backend node established
Tom_Wang
@TomWang10
@ppratscher could you pls help me~
Peter Pratscher
@ppratscher
your prysm node returns invalid data
maybe you are running an older version?
Tom_Wang
@TomWang10
what is correct version?
Peter Pratscher
@ppratscher
latest master
Tom_Wang
@TomWang10
it work!thanks for you help!
Peter Pratscher
@ppratscher
:+1:
Peter Pratscher
@ppratscher
Today we added the ability to do a full db reindex on startup, this is quite usefull if you want to do a full reindex of the db without emptying the db beforehand
Peter Pratscher
@ppratscher
Next new feature is the display of the historic effective balance evolution of a validator alongside the total balance history
Peter Pratscher
@ppratscher
just pushed a large update that among other things changes the db schema, so you will need to drop & recreate the db and re-index the whole chain
the new version is now able to correctly show all validators that participated in an attestation
Peter Pratscher
@ppratscher
The explorer is now able to show the LMD GHOST votes cast for a specific block, see block https://beaconcha.in/block/155926 for an example
Tom_Wang
@TomWang10
image.png
@ppratscher Hi, I run explorer on my own beacon chain. It looks like it shows wrong data
Peter Pratscher
@ppratscher
Maybe your beacon node is not fully synced?
Tom_Wang
@TomWang10
I only have two nodes on my network
sync status is always latest
Peter Pratscher
@ppratscher
any errors in your explorer logs?
Peter Pratscher
@ppratscher
During the weekend we added lots of updates to the explorer:
  • Correct handling of orphaned blocks, orphaned blocks now get the status "Orphaned" and are shown alongside the regular blocks
  • Validator public keys can now be conveniently copied to the clipboard on the validator page
  • The data of the index site is now auto-refreshed every 15 seconds, no need to press F5 to refresh the site any more
Anish Agnihotri
@Anish-Agnihotri
Hey folks. I had chimed in a couple of weeks ago about hopping in and helping w/ design + front-end once the explorer was open-sourced. Happy to help in now and help out. Let me know if you had any initial ideas, else, I'll open up an issue thread and get a PR going.
Peter Pratscher
@ppratscher
Hi Anish, thanks a lot for your help. Regarding the frontend we don't have any specific ideas besides that the layout should be responsive and easy to navigate. I guess everything that distinguishes it from standard bootstrap should work fine. @stefan_star_twitter is our frontend engineer who will be able to help you in case you run into any issues
I guess a good point to start with would be to modify the existing standard bootstrap theme
Peter Pratscher
@ppratscher
Today we added a dedicated charting module, currently it shows charts for proposed blocks, active validators, staked ether and we will add more charts over time
mkinney
@mkinney
Thanks for all of your hard work on this. It really looks great!
Are you open to having a PR that will deal with golint warnings?
Peter Pratscher
@ppratscher
Sure, any help is appreciated!
mkinney
@mkinney
Great. I've actually already started. Most of the comments will be pretty basic.
Peter Pratscher
@ppratscher
Looks great so far, thanks
mkinney
@mkinney
PR is ready.
I don't see any unit tests nor any integration tests.
:-(
Peter Pratscher
@ppratscher
We started just a month ago, still working on testing